I don't agree. However you look at it. It will always be Ethiopia. A lot has changed in Egypt. The fact that Egypt was colonised by Britain between 1882 & 1922 puts Egypt out of contention for the title of oldest African country. Same goes for Sudan. First,it was a vassalage of Muhammed Ali's Egypt from 1825 to 1898 from which it came under joint British and Egyptian rule as Anglo-Egyptian Sudan. Sudan did not become independent until 1956. Ethiopia on the other hand has enjoyed an a long and unbroken period of continuous existence as an independent State. Longer than any other African country and comparable to that of Japan (661 BC),China (221Bc) and San Marino,three of the oldest countries in the world. Take it from me my friend Ethiopia is indeed Africa's OLDEST country. Egypt and Sudan don't stand a chance.
